Notes
Recorded March 4 and 7, 1971, Sankei Hall, Tokyo, Japan.Originally released as ABC-LP (Japan) 841, "Live In Japan" as a double LP, 1971.
This is the first release outside of Japan of the entire double album. Portions of the album have previously been issued in th U.S. and elsewhere on "King Of The Blues" box set (MCAD4-10677) (two songs) and "How Blue Can You Get? Classic Live Performances 1965 to 1994" (MCAD2-11443) (four songs).
